Transaction 2e427be0475222f23d20b814c09beba36cc3b4aa095e9d98e2b117ea784b63e6

1 Input
2 Outputs
  • 2e427be0475222f23d20b814c09beba36cc3b4aa095e9d98e2b117ea784b63e6:0
  • value  38189803
    address  13k3HtDXaRsjw4LVLbAw5M1CngbEbtFkEJ
  • 2e427be0475222f23d20b814c09beba36cc3b4aa095e9d98e2b117ea784b63e6:1
  • value  1104943546
    address  37d95dZxeNdwcUEqQea4roYn6XyiT1kntC